Keys to ignition

Keys for ignition (also known as transponder keys) are used to start your volvo xc60 replacement key cost uk car. They are equipped with a microchip which transmits a message to the antenna ring when they are inserted into the ignition. The engine control unit reads the code to determine whether the key is legitimate. These keys are a good security measure to guard your Volvo.

A locksmith that specializes in Volvos can also fix or replace the ignition lock cylinder. This is a great option if the key is difficult to insert or pull out of the ignition. This could indicate that the wafer tumblers are worn out.

It is important to determine the main reason your Volvo car key isn't working before hiring an service provider. It could not be a problem with the key in the slightest; instead, it could be an issue with the cylinder that controls ignition. In this instance replacement of the cylinder will be more complicated than making a new key.

Keyless Entry Keys

Volvo's crossovers as well as cars come with keyless entry, controlled by key fobs. These are more secure than conventional keys because they use wireless signals to activate the ignition system of your car. If you lose your key fob or the batteries die, you can either replace it or have it reprogrammed. Our Volvo experts can help you through the process.

Certain kinds of keyless entry systems allow you to lock or unlock your car when you touch the door handle which is beneficial for those who lead busy lives. These systems can deter break-ins because there isn't a physical key made of metal that could be copied, or mechanical steering column locks that could easily be broken.

These keyless systems also allow you to start your engine without having a physical key, which is why they are extremely useful for disabled individuals or those living in areas that are snowy. These systems are hard to replace if lost or stolen.

Key fobs are vulnerable to spoofing. The thieves utilize specially designed receivers to duplicate or copy the signal of your key. The newest fobs are designed to address these concerns with an immobilizer which communicates with the antenna and thereby prevents duplicate keys that are not authorized.

Transponder Keys

The most recent Volvo models are equipped with a particular type of key known as transponder keys. This type of key helps ensure that only the right key is able to start your car. The key fob is equipped with an electronic chip that sends a signal to the antenna in the engine of your Volvo. If the signal isn't recognized by the immobilizer, it will stop your engine and stop you from starting your car. To replace a Volvo transponder key, you'll need contact the dealership. A locksmith can program a key directly into the Volvo immobilizer by using a tool.
